Verbs
The verbs ser (to be) and r ir (to go) are irregular and have the r
same form in the preterite:
fui [fwee] I was; I went
foste [fohsht] you were (sing, fam);
you went (sing, fam)
foi [foh-i] he/she/it was, you were (sing, pol);
he/she/it went, you went (sing, pol)
fomos [fohmoosh] we were; we went
foram [fohrowng] they were, you were (pl, pol);
they went, you went (pl)
